Pune, Feb. 9 -- Manjusha Nagpure of the BJP was elected unopposed as the Pune Mayor on Monday.

Parshuram Wadekar-originally from the RPI and elected on the BJP symbol-was elected as Deputy Mayor.

NCP's Shital Sawant and Congress's Ashwini Landge withdrew from the mayoral election, while NCP's Dattatraya Bahirat and Congress's Sahil Kedari withdrew from the deputy mayoral election.

As the BJP holds an absolute majority in the Pune Municipal Corporation, the victory of Nagpure and Wadekar in this election was certain. Both were elected unopposed.
